Abstract

This collection is a family photo album from between 1922-1925. The photographs are of a girls' trip out to Yellowstone, where they lived and worked for a summer. There are also a couple of newspaper clippings and decals from Yellowstone in the book. The photographs show what it was like to work and live in Yellowstone during the early 20th century. Some interesting pictures are of bears eating out of the dump that was there until the 1960s and pictures of old bus parts at Mammoth.

Scope and Contents of the Materials

The collection contains a black, leather photo album from 1922-1925 with over 400 black and white photographs. These are photographs of Yellowstone Park and a couple of ranches where the travelers stayed.
